Fresh fruit is always appreciated when it comes to kava. Kava tea and drinks are often seen as the healthier alternative to alcohol, and while adding a touch of fresh fruit to rims seems logical to enhance visual appearance, it is also gives a sense of freshness.
Whether it is sliced mango, pineapple, oranges, strawberries, raspberries, blueberries, they are all great small menu items that can be used to upsell with any kava drink. Just a handful of fresh fruit accompanies well with a traditional bowl of kava.
Fruit mashes are an original way of accompanying a traditional kava bowl and used as a chaser to give a fresh fruity finish in your mouth. These can be made with whatever fruit you have in stock and are very easy to make.
